LEONARD JUSTUS GORSUCH

Leonard Gorsuch

Leonard J. Gorsuch, 81, of rural Astoria, died at 12:40 a.m. Friday, March 12, 1999, at Graham Hospital in Canton.

He was born Oct. 27, 1917, in Woodland Township, Fulton County, a son of Earl and Amy Hendee Gorsuch. He married Frieda Shawgo on Nov. 8, 1941, in Palmyra, Mo. She died Feb. 13, 1992. He also was preceded in death by two sisters and one half sister.

Surviving are two daughters, Mrs. Richard (Shirley) Keeler and Mrs. Phillip (Judy) Webb, both of Lewistown; two sons, Donald of Canton and John of Astoria; 11 grandchildren; six great-grandchildren; three step-great-grandchildren; one brother, Earl Gorsuch Jr. of Ipava; five half brothers, Norman Gorsuch of Astoria, Terry Gorsuch and Larry Gorsuch, both of Havana, Gary Gorsuch of Sebring, Fla., and Bob Gorsuch of Canton; and one half sister, Sandra Servis of Canton.

He was an accountant at Camp Ellis near Ipava during World War II. He also farmed in the Astoria area. He later was owner and operator of Gorsuch Radio and Television in Summum.

Services were held Monday at Shawgo Memorial Home in Astoria with Collis Trone officiating. Burial was in Summum Cemetery.
Memorials may be made to the Astoria Rescue Squad.
